Post subject:  plug in carts failure

I've had my outback for 4 years and just had the weld break on my second cart frame where the top horizontal bar is welded to the uprights. :cry:
I roll my kayak on it's side, plug the cart in and roll it back on the cart. Am I doing something wrong? :? :?

Some older carts had inferior welds. A welding shop can re-weld (stainless steel) easily.

Thank you Matt. I tried that on the first rack. When I arrived home I realized The welder didn't line up the parts- result- it wouldn't slide back in to my scupper holes. I paid for the weld and had to buy a new set of wheels.
Do you have a part number for the wheel rack alone? I don't need axle wheels or pad or other parts. Also Is there any guarantee I won't get an inferior weld a third time?

Frame only is: 80045011 HOBIE FRAME STD/HVY CART
